寒区道路桥梁融雪除冰技术研究综述

道路桥面的融雪除冰对车辆行驶安全至关重要,但是目前对于融雪除冰技术的研究主要集中在工程效果及技术评价上,尚未从除冰工作机理进行对比分析和系统阐述.该文基于融雪除冰机理将融雪除冰技术分为被动式除冰技术、主动融雪除冰技术以及能量利用型融雪除冰技术3类,并对其进行归纳总结.系统评价了融雪剂除冰法、机械除冰法两项传统除冰手段的优缺点;探讨了抑制类冻结铺装路面、相变材料路面两项主动融雪除冰技术,并提出相变材料用于路面融雪除冰具有绿色环保价值;介绍了不同能量利用型融雪除冰技术的应用机理.深入分析现有的道路除雪技术及其实际应用效果和存在的问题,以期对寒区道路桥梁冬季融雪除冰研究提供基础性支撑.
Review of Snow and Ice Melting Techniques for Road and Bridge in Cold Regions
Snow and ice melting of road and bridge surfaces is crucial for traffic safety,but current research on snow and ice melting techniques mainly focuses on engineering effects and technical evaluation,without the analysis and elaboration from the perspective of their mechanisms.To this end,based on the different mechanisms,this study divided snow and ice melting techniques into three types and summarized them:passive deicing,active deicing,and energy utilization deicing.This study systematically evaluated the advantages and disadvantages of traditional deicing methods such as deicing agents and mechanical deicing,analyzed two active deicing techniques,namely inhibitive freezing pavement and phase change material pavement,discussed the environmental-friendly method for road deicing by using phase change materials,and introduced the mechanisms of different energy utilization deicing techniques.This study analyzed the existing road deicing techniques,their actual application effects,and existing problems,to provide foundational support for the research of snow and ice melting on roads and bridges in cold regions.
